Catalog description
(cross-leveled with MATH 4370 ). This course covers the main probability tools applied to financial risk modeling, and the financial mathematics concepts used in calculating present and accumulated values for various cash flows. It is a helpful tool in preparing for the Society of Actuaries exams P (Probability) and FM (Financial Mathematics), and it is oriented towards problem solving techniques illustrated with previous exam problems. Students are encouraged to take MATH 4355 prior to this course. Credit Hour s : 3 Prerequisites: MATH 2300 , MATH 4320 / STAT 4750
